Virginia Lanier Books In Order

Jo Beth Sidden “Bloodhound” Mystery Books In Publication Order

  1. Death in Bloodhound Red (1995)
  2. The House on Bloodhound Lane (1996)
  3. A Brace of Bloodhounds (1997)
  4. Blind Bloodhound Justice (1998)
  5. Ten Little Bloodhounds (1999)
  6. A Bloodhound To Die For (2003)

Death in Bloodhound Red

Jo Beth Siddon is a bloodhound trainer with a special talent for harrowing search and rescue missions, and a bad habit for mouthing off to deputies who refuse to take orders from a woman. She has seen her share of trouble: moonshiners poking guns at her head, crooked cops, and an abusive ex husband with a terrible temper. Then she’s suspected of murder and finds herself treading a quagmire as thick and treacherous as the Okefenokee Swamp. If she can’t prove her innocence, she might lose not only the thriving business she loves, but the freedom and independence she’s fought for all her life.

The House on Bloodhound Lane

Lanier does for bloodhounds what Dick Francis does for racehorses in her atmospheric, and critically applauded, novels set in rural Georgia. Jo Beth Sidden is a fiercely independent woman who raises and trains bloodhounds for search and rescue missions and to track down escaped prisoners in South Georgia’s Okefenokee Swamp. Jo Beth’s got her hands full when the local police chief hires her to sniff out a local mari*juana grower and a friend asks her to locate a kidnapped man even though the FBI is on the case. And when her sociopath of an ex husband Bubba gets out of prison and begins stalking her, Jo Beth will need to use all her skills and her bloodhounds to outwit Bubba, to help the police and to best the FBI. ‘Lanier’s writing blends white hot intensity with a lyrical sense of place that can render even a sticky humid Okefenokee Swamp as a setting I can’t wait to visit again.’ Margaret Maron, bestselling author and winner of the Edgar, Agatha and Anthony Awards

Ten Little Bloodhounds

Ten Little Bloodhounds are just the tip of the trouble in this fifth outing in Virginia Lanier’s award winning mystery series featuring Jo Beth Sidden and the smartest, sweetest team of search and rescue dogs in the South. Jo Beth runs her own business training and selling bloodhounds. With her best dogs she also braves the dangers in and around the Okefenokee Swamp to find lost children, escaped convicts, and illegal stashes. On occasion, she’s been known to investigate a crime or two. In her latest case, Jo Beth is hired by a reclusive, wealthy island matriarch to find her lost cat. Shortly thereafter, her client is murdered, and the lawyers hire Jo Beth to find the culprit. There is a slew of suspects, all potential heirs to the matriarch’s fortune. Only one is a killer. Meanwhile, a full litter of ten baby hounds is expected back at the kennel. This rare, difficult birth isn’t just a matter close to Jo Beth’s heart. It will also be a much needed boon for her business. The quicker Jo Beth can solve this case, the sooner she can get home to her dogs and get her life in order. But she’s in for a surprise, and a fight she’ll never forget. Ten Little Bloodhounds is a beat the clock mystery with a masterful mix of deception, danger, and down home sleuthing.

A Bloodhound To Die For

In the sixth novel in this popular, award winning mystery series, Georgia peach Jo Beth Sidden returns with her delightfully fast on their feet bloodhounds. Dog trainer and amateur sleuth extraordinaire, Jo Beth is in a heap of trouble. For openers, she has to dig herself out of a personal crisis. Confronted by her violent ex husband, Bubba, Jo Beth ended the relationship for good with a bang. Now she has to rebuild her life and, in between, give a little help to her friends who are in dire need of a good detective. She’s on the trail of a prison escapee, a good ol’ boy so wily that even Jo Beth’s best hounds can’t sniff him out. Meanwhile, she’s busy tracking an elderly woman who has wandered off in the Okefenokee Swamp, and at the same time searching for the source of a rumor that resulted in three deaths.
